Web26 jan. 2024 · The way wet sanding works is that it sands away a certain layer of the vehicle’s clear coat. This is done to fix severely defective paint and scratches. Of course, the process doesn’t leave the shine you want and once it has been completed, you have to apply a heavy cutting polish, which brings back the gloss and shine. WebTime frame. Generally, it is safe to wet sand spray paint 24 hours after it has been applied. However, this can vary depending on the type of paint, thickness, temperature, and humidity. 3.
